S-E boys fall short to Adirondack

ADIRONDACK – On Friday, the Sherburne-Earlville Timberwolves boys’ basketball team traveled to Adirondack, where they fell in a one-point deficit 53-52 in overtime. The Wildcats made the final shot to win the game.

Both teams played neck-and-neck, where they tied for every quarter, sending the game into overtime, where the Wildcats outscored S-E 6-5 with the final shot to secure the victory.

Garret Winton led the Timberwolves with 19 points as Nick Hull followed with 13 points, including three three-pointers. Brayden O’Hara finished with eight points.
